In the early morning hours, without warning, airstrikes tore through Old Fangak, a remote corner of South Sudan.

The bombs hit the only hospital serving over 40,000 people. Lives were lost. More were injured. The building was destroyed.

But the damage goes far beyond the rubble.

This hospital was a critical referral point for UNFPA’s mobile teams delivering emergency maternal care. It was a place where pregnant women received skilled support, survivors of sexual violence could access critical services, and girls found shelter and care.

Health facilities across the region are being targeted in conflict. This is part of a dangerous trend of destroying essential care services.

We cannot let this become the new normal, especially in a country where 2.4 million women of reproductive age out of 9.3 million are in need of humanitarian assistance.

And it’s not just South Sudan. In the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C), UNFPA Safe Spaces are the only refuge for countless women and girls living with the daily threat of sexual violence and armed conflict. These sanctuaries provide access to essential services such as psychosocial support, healthcare, and legal assistance.
